PENG Yujia


 

Dr. Yujia PENG is an assistant professor at the School of Psychological and Cognitive Sciences at Peking University, also affiliated to the Institute of Artificial Intelligence at PKU, and to the State Key Laboratory of General Artificial Intelligence, BIGAI. Dr. Peng received her B.S. degree from Peking University, and her Ph.D. from the University of California Los Angeles. Her research focuses on computational psychiatry with an aim to reveal cognitive neural mechanisms underlying depression and anxiety, and also involves the interdisciplinary research of human cognition and artificial intelligence. Her research methods include human behavioral experiments, brain imaging, computational modeling, and machine learning. Her research has been published in journals of Biological psychiatry: CNNI, Psychological Science, Engineering, etc. Dr. Peng serves as a guest editor of Psychological review, Journal of Anxiety Disorders, and as an editorial board member of Behaviour Research and Therapy.
